Position Title: Science Engagement Manager Department: Science Engagement Reports to: Director of Education Pay Class: Full-time Regular   Position Summary The Science Engagement Manager (SEM) leads the Science Engagement team to deliver exceptional guest engagement experiences that inspire curiosity and conversation through a range of activities on the public floor, including live science shows on stage and in the planetarium, and small group interactives in the exhibit halls. Bringing an innovation mindset to evolving science engagement practices, particularly where anti-racism, equity, access, inclusion and diversity is concerned, is highly encouraged.   Overall responsibilities include staff recruiting, training, and scheduling, creating and managing a departmental budget, managing relevant evaluation efforts and ensuring that program delivery expectations are fulfilled. This exciting role is a critical contributor to Pacific Science Center’s mission to ignite curiosity in every child and fuel a passion for discovery, experimentation, and critical thinking in all of us.   Essential Duties & Responsibilities Working collaboratively within and across teams to ensure quality guest engagement experience by helping to define, refine, iterate and deliver science engagement offerings and programs. Programming offered by the Science Engagement team includes: Live presentations that for small and large groups take place in a planetarium, physical stage, and Science on a Sphere Small cart science demonstrations, and one-on-one and small group interactions Ensure staff have skills to effectively serve a variety of audience group sizes and types, including all ages general admission, onsite school field trips, special events and private event rental interpretive experiences Modeling effective program delivery and content development approaches while utilizing innovation where and when it will improve those efforts Being able to effectively create, communicate and implement programmatic vision. Actively seeking ways to incorporate other ways of knowing and understanding in program development Leading in the recruitment, training, scheduling and support of a science engagement team of diverse facilitators. Nurturing excellence in science engagement staff by encouraging professional development, personal growth and skills building Effectively communicating between multiple departments and programs in day to day operations; problem solving to resolve issues that may arise and stepping in where additional support is required Leading the department in data management, including accurately engaging in systems for daily scheduling, time card approvals, daily updates, and program attendance tracking Creating and managing a smart departmental budget that balances the needs of staffing and programming with fiscal practicality Serving as project manager for projects that advance Science Engagement and organizational efforts Other projects and responsibilities may be added at the organization’s discretion   Position Requirements: Knowledge, Skills, Abilities Knowledge of: Personal bias and a desire to be and lead others to be anti-racist educators Informal learning education practices of free choice learning in museum-type spaces Effective staff and program management practices Utilizing STEM education in informal learning environments Skills: Highly organized, strong attention to detail, and excellent interpersonal skills Proficiency in software including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ook, and file sharing programs such as SharePoint; ability to learn quickly learn new software and hardware systems Proven clear verbal and written communication skills, including public speaking and performance techniques Excellent customer service skills including the ability to represent Pacific Science Center’s mission and focus on guest experience Budget creation and tracking Ability to: Bring a flexible and innovative mindset to this work including problem solving Manage multiple projects through prioritization and planning Manage expectations and convey priorities to other departments requesting support Work independently and as well with teams Thrive in a fast-paced, guest facing environment   Qualifications Required Minimum 3 years of experience working with K-8 students in a formal and/or informal educational setting, such as a museum, after-school program, or youth camp Minimum two years of staff supervisory experience Minimum two years of program operations experience Work must be performed onsite. In order to adequately support science engagement team, schedules will flex based on seasonal cycle needs throughout the year and range from working full weekends to some weekend days and some evenings pending seasonal adjustments Preferred Knowledge of present trends in informal science education Fluency in second language such as but not limited to Spanish, Somali, Mandarin, ASL, and/or Vietnamese Museum Studies experience, Interpretation Certification, and/or Teaching Certification Volunteer management experience Adult education experience in a formal and/or informal education setting   This position description generally describes the principal functions of the position and the level of knowledge and skills typically required.
